After finishing her university education overseas, Sam reluctantly returns to assist her older, pregnant sister, Trish after their parents’ sudden and tragic passing. Her grieving is clouded by a city, and a family, she can barely recognize. Meanwhile, Eric, in town for stunt work on an action movie, feels even more a foreigner. Having been away for a longer period, Eric doesn’t even speak Tagalog anymore, a fact that troubles him when he goes to visit his Lola. Meeting as former classmates, Sam and Eric connect over this shared hollow feeling and, after a late night break-in to their old high school, Sam tells Eric: “I really thought that coming back would feel more like coming home.” It’s a sentiment that pervades Sam and Eric’s personal journeys of self-discovery. (Los Angeles Asian Pacific Film Festival)
